Understanding Each Key Type

  1. Conventional Keys

    • These are the a lot of standard keys used in older cars. They are normally made of metal and function no electronic components. Replacement is often uncomplicated and normally needs a locksmith professional or dealer.
  2. Transponder Keys

    • Transponder keys come equipped with a chip that sends an unique signal to the vehicle's ignition system. If the key isn't acknowledged, the vehicle won't begin. Replacing a transponder key typically includes not just cutting a new key but likewise programming the chip, which can increase both the intricacy and cost of replacement.
  3. Smart Keys

    • Smart keys utilize innovative technology enabling keyless entry and ignition. Instead of placing a key, motorists must have the wise key within proximity to begin their vehicle. Changing clever keys can be expensive due to the technology involved.
  4. Remote Key Fobs

    • These gadgets make it possible for remote locks and other functions like panic buttons or trunk release. Replacement often consists of the requirement to integrate the fob with the vehicle's system, which can be done through a dealer or a locksmith.
  5. Valet Keys

    • Created for temporary use, these keys typically supply access to just vital functions. The replacement procedure is comparable to standard keys, as they don't contain any advanced components.

The Car Key Replacement Process

The process for changing a car key can differ depending upon the key type and the car design. Here's a basic overview of the steps included:

Step-by-Step Key Replacement Process

  1. Determine the Key Type:

  2. Collect Necessary Information:

    • Have your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) and proof of ownership prepared to assist in the replacement process.
  3. Pick a Replacement Method:

    • Dealership: The most dependable approach, but typically the most costly. Best for wise keys and complicated transponder keys.
    • Locksmith: A more inexpensive alternative if handling traditional or some transponder keys. Search for professionals in automotive keys.
    • Online Services: Websites exist that deal key cutting and programming services; however, care is recommended with possible security threats.
  4. Program the Key:

    • If relevant, programming must be performed to sync the brand-new key with the vehicle's systems. This can require customized devices frequently offered at a car dealership or automotive key replacement locksmith professional.
  5. Test the Key:

    • After replacement, test the new key's functionality to ensure it runs all car functions, including ignition and remote functions.

Expenses of Car Key Replacement

The costs of car key replacements can differ commonly based on multiple aspects, such as key type, vehicle make and design, and the replacement technique. Below is a breakdown of normal costs connected with numerous key types.

Key TypeApproximated Cost Range
Traditional Keys₤ 2 - ₤ 10
Transponder Keys₤ 50 - ₤ 250
Smart Keys₤ 200 - ₤ 600
Remote Key Fobs₤ 50 - ₤ 300
Valet Keys₤ 5 - ₤ 20

Extra Factors Affecting Cost

  • Complexity of Programming: The more complex the key innovation, the greater the shows cost.
  • Area: Prices may vary by area due to varying labor rates and expense of living.
  • Emergency Services: Expect to pay more for immediate or emergency locksmith services, particularly outside routine service hours.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. The length of time does it require to replace a car key?

The time taken differs based upon the type of key and the replacement method. For standard keys, it might take simply a few minutes. For advanced clever keys, it can take longer due to shows.

2. What if I've lost my car keys totally?

If you've lost all your keys, you may require to call a car dealership for a total key reprogramming and replacement since they can create a new key based upon your VIN.

3. Can I still drive my car without a key?

No, you can not. If you've lost your key, you'll require to replace it before you can begin the vehicle once again.

4. Is it possible to set a brand-new key myself?

While it's possible for some easier keys, the majority of modern keys-- especially transponder and smart keys-- need specialized equipment and skills for appropriate programming.
